Healthcare Assistant: With a 35% share, healthcare assistants are the most prominent role in the health and social care sector. This position involves working closely with patients, providing basic care, and ensuring their well-being. 2. Social Worker: Comprising 25% of the sector, social workers play a critical role in supporting vulnerable individuals and families. Social workers collaborate with various organizations and local authorities to address complex challenges and promote social welfare. 3. Mental Health Nurse: Mental health nurses represent approximately 20% of the health and social care workforce. They specialize in assessing, treating, and supporting individuals with mental health conditions, making a significant contribution to the overall well-being of patients. 4. Occupational Therapist: Occupational therapists account for 10% of the sector. They help patients develop, recover, and maintain the skills needed for daily living and working, enabling them to engage in meaningful activities and contribute to society. 5. Physiotherapist: Physiotherapists make up the remaining 10% of the health and social care sector. They assess, treat, and manage a wide range of physical conditions, injuries, and disabilities, helping patients regain mobility and improve their quality of life.
